摘要
用交叉谱分析方法研究近地面大气折射指数N单位平均值、月降水总量与太阳黑子相对数之间多频振动特征。结果发现:初夏,N单位与太阳黑子(或降水量)在准5年及准2年(或准7年、准4年及准3年)周期附近有十分密切的关系;初秋,N单位与太阳黑子在准5年、准2年周期附近密切相关;N单位与降水量除在短周期准3年、准2年附近有密切关系外,在长周期准35年附近亦有较密切的关系。
By using the cross spectrum analysis method,studies are made of the multi-frequency oncillation characteristics of the N unit average of the surface atmospheric re-fraction index related to the total monthly rainfall and the relative number of sunspots.It is found that in early summer there exists a very close relation between the N unit andsunspots (or rainfall) around the periods of quasi-five and quasi-two years (or quasi-seven, quasi-four and quasi-three years) and in early autumn a close relation be-tween the N unit and sunspots around the periods of quasi-five and quasi-two years.And the N unit is found to have a close relation with rainfall not only around the shortperiods of quasi-three and quasi-two years but also around the long period of quasi-35 years.
